Does a teaspoon keep champagne fizzy?

15 April 2014

Question

My dad wanted to know why champagne stays fizzy if you put a teaspoon in the top of the bottle once you take the cork out.

Answer

Chris - We're almost out of time but we've got this one here from Kitty. We can have a sort of show of hands on this - does putting a teaspoon in the top of a bottle of champagne stop it going flat? Who believes that one?

Helen - I've never come across that actually. That's the first time I've heard that.

Chris - People say it stops it going flat, but it's not true. It's a myth I'm afraid, Kitty. It doesn't work.

Ramsey - Yes, the air is still exposed in the champagne.

Chris:: Yeah. I mean basically, the gas under pressure dissolved can bubble out and escape and the teaspoon does not make any difference.
